    Hello Fellas!! Here is a list of the things I have mentioned in the video:
    Utensils:
    - Pressure cooker !!!!!!! NECESSARY!!!!!!!
    - Kadhai if necessary
    - Steel spatula and ladle
    - Tea strainer (Chai ki channi), if you are a tea enthusiast
    - Plate, cup, spoons, glass, fork, knife, bowl 1 each (check with the residence if it is furnished)
    Food ingredients:
    - Tea leaves, if you drink some special Indian tea
    - Maggi masala
    - Ghee, check with airlines and other guidelines
    - Pickles can be found here too
    - A few basic masala powders for your initial days
    Website to check ingredients: www.annachi.fr/
    Suggestions
    - A small box of your chosen khada masalas(whole spice)
    - A masala box with 7-8 small sections
    - Regional masala powder (if any)
    For Women
    - A small pack of sanitary napkins/pads/tampons
    - Lakme cosmetics, if you are particular
    - Hair oil, check airline guidelines and carry a sealed bottle
    - Kajal/kohl
    Clothes
    - Traditional clothes/Saree/suit, if you wish to wear on special festival or occasion
    - One comfortable pair of shoes
    Student supply:
    - Two pens, 1 notebook.
    - A scientific calculator.
    Electronics:
    - European 2 pin adapter,
    - Phone, camera, airpods, headphones,speaker charger.
    - A proper working phone.
    - International Roaming Pack
    Medical needs:
    - Spectacles : 2 pairs
    - Carry a small packet of medicines, but make sure to get a prescription and carry it in cabin bag.
    - Moov spray/cream
    Finance:
    - Take a forex card/international credit card with a backup card if possible
    Bedding:
    - Mostly the houses are furnished but still would recommend a pillow cover and bed sheet
    - A towel
    - A mug for bathroom
